Why Measuring Real-Time Robotic Responses Matters
In high-speed pick-and-place operations, even slight delays or inaccuracies can significantly impact production efficiency and product quality. A robots real-time response is crucial for maintaining precise control over the entire process. This includes picking up components at the right speed, placing them accurately in designated areas, and repeating these actions with precision.
However, without accurate measurement of a robots responses, manufacturers might not be aware of inefficiencies or inaccuracies within their processes. This lack of visibility can lead to reduced productivity, increased defect rates, and higher costs over time.

A Closer Look at the Measuring Real-Time Robotic Responses Process
Eurolabs laboratory service employs cutting-edge technology to measure the real-time responses of robotic systems in high-speed pick-and-place operations. This involves a thorough analysis of several key factors, including
- Response Time The time it takes for the robot to react and perform its designated tasks.
- Accuracy How closely the robot places components or parts matches the intended target.
- Consistency Whether the robots performance is consistent over multiple cycles.
This comprehensive analysis provides a detailed understanding of the robotic systems capabilities, enabling Eurolab experts to offer tailored recommendations for improvement. These may include adjustments to the process parameters, changes in the robots programming, or even the selection of more suitable equipment.
